It all depends on your environment ...

 

Are you building SAPUI5 applications served from the JAVA stack of the NW portal ?

 

As an alternative you could indeed use the SAP JCO indeed to connect to an R/3 ABAP stack, execute the RFC and expose the results as a JSON HTTP result using eg a java HTTP servlet. I would reckon there might be quite some open source JSON java libraries available which would provide that information ...  In this solution you would at least limit the custom developments on the ERP backends ... there simply needs to be a (custom) RFC available.

 

I reckon there should be plenty of tutorials on JCO development if you search on them on SDN.

 

The ABAP eclipse plugin is not required for any  ABAP developments ... it can be an alternative for the standard SAP SE80 environment (so if you want to develop from within Eclipse ) ...  and it is free of charge btw and can be downloaded via the normal SAP eclipse update sites ...
